An Enterprise Resource Planning project represents one of the most significant technological and operational undertakings an organization can embark upon. At its core, an ERP system integrates various business functions—such as finance, human resources, supply chain, manufacturing, and customer relationship management—into a single, unified system. The primary goal of an enterprise resource planning project is to streamline processes, improve data visibility, and enhance decision-making across the entire organization. Given its complexity and far-reaching impact, a successful ERP implementation requires meticulous planning, strong leadership, and a clear understanding of both the challenges and opportunities involved.
The journey of an enterprise resource planning project typically begins with a thorough needs assessment and vendor selection process. This initial phase is critical, as it sets the foundation for everything that follows. Companies must evaluate their current processes, identify pain points, and define clear objectives for what they hope to achieve with the new system. This involves input from stakeholders across all departments to ensure the selected solution aligns with the unique requirements of the business. Key considerations during this stage include:
- Scalability: The system’s ability to grow with the business.
- Customization: The flexibility to adapt to specific industry or company needs.
- Total Cost of Ownership: Including licensing, implementation, training, and maintenance.
- Vendor reputation and support services.
- Integration capabilities with existing software and future technologies.
Once a vendor is selected, the enterprise resource planning project moves into the planning and design phase. This stage involves mapping out business processes, configuring the software, and developing a detailed project plan. A dedicated project team, comprising both internal staff and external consultants, is essential to manage the myriad tasks and timelines. Executive sponsorship is also crucial to secure the necessary resources and overcome organizational resistance to change. Data migration is another critical component, as historical data must be cleaned, validated, and transferred into the new system without compromising integrity.
The implementation phase is where the enterprise resource planning project truly comes to life. This often involves a phased approach, starting with pilot departments or locations before a full-scale rollout. Key activities during this period include system configuration, customization, and extensive testing—including unit testing, integration testing, and user acceptance testing (UAT). Training is paramount; end-users must be equipped with the knowledge and skills to utilize the new system effectively. Resistance to change is a common hurdle, which can be mitigated through clear communication, involving users in the process, and demonstrating the tangible benefits of the new system.
Despite the potential for transformative benefits, an enterprise resource planning project is not without its challenges. Common pitfalls include scope creep, where project requirements expand beyond the original plan, leading to delays and budget overruns. Inadequate testing can result in system glitches that disrupt operations post-go-live. Poor data quality can undermine the entire initiative, as the new system is only as good as the data it contains. Furthermore, underestimating the cultural impact of such a significant change can lead to low user adoption and ultimately, project failure. To mitigate these risks, organizations should:
- Establish a clear project scope and adhere to it rigorously.
- Invest in robust change management and communication strategies.
- Allocate sufficient time and resources for data cleansing and migration.
- Conduct thorough and iterative testing at every stage.
- Choose an experienced implementation partner with a proven track record.
However, the rewards of a successfully executed enterprise resource planning project are substantial. Organizations can achieve greater operational efficiency by automating routine tasks and eliminating redundant processes. Real-time data access provides a single source of truth, enabling faster and more informed decision-making. Improved collaboration across departments breaks down silos, fostering a more cohesive and agile organization. Enhanced customer service becomes possible through better inventory management, faster order processing, and a 360-degree view of customer interactions. Ultimately, a well-implemented ERP system can provide a significant competitive advantage, driving growth and innovation.
Looking ahead, the future of the enterprise resource planning project is being shaped by emerging technologies. Cloud-based ERP solutions are gaining popularity due to their lower upfront costs, scalability, and easier updates. The integration of artificial intelligence and machine learning is enabling predictive analytics and intelligent automation, transforming ERP from a system of record to a system of intelligence. The Internet of Things (IoT) is connecting physical assets to the ERP system, providing real-time data on equipment performance and supply chain movements. These advancements are making ERP systems more powerful and accessible than ever before.
In conclusion, an enterprise resource planning project is a complex but invaluable endeavor for any organization seeking to modernize its operations and thrive in a digital economy. Its success hinges on strategic planning, cross-functional collaboration, and a steadfast commitment to managing change. By understanding the critical phases—from selection and planning to implementation and beyond—and proactively addressing potential challenges, businesses can harness the full power of ERP to achieve seamless integration, unparalleled insights, and sustainable growth. The journey may be demanding, but the destination—a more efficient, agile, and data-driven enterprise—is well worth the effort.